The Hexadecimal Color #DCA943 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#DCA943 RGB value is rgb(220, 169, 67). RGB Color Model of #DCA943 consists of 86% red, 66% green and 26% blue. HSL color Mode of #DCA943 has 40°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 56% Lightness. #DCA943 color has an wavelength of 594.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DCA943 is #FFCC66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DCA943 is #DA4. The Closest Color to #DCA943 is #DAA520. Official Name of #DCA943 Hex Code is Roti.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DCA943 is 0 Cyan 23 Magenta 70 Yellow 14 Black and #DCA943 CMY is 0, 23, 70.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DCA943

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
